CSE2022
Consider the following statements
- "The Climate Group" is an international non-profit organization that drives climate action by building large networks and runs them
- The International Energy Agency in partnership with the Climate Group launched a global initiative "EP100"
- EP100 brings together leading companies committed to driving innovation in energy efficiency and increasing competitiveness while delivering on emission reduction goals
- Some Indian companies are members of EP100
- The International Energy Agency is the Secretariat to the "Under2 Coalition"
Which of the statements given above are correct?
- A 1, 2, 4 and 5
- B 1, 3 and 4 only ✓
- C 2, 3 and 5 only
- D 1, 2, 3, 4 and 5
✓ Correct answer: (B)
